About Sinotrans

Sinotrans Limited provides integrated logistics services primarily in the People’s Republic of China. It operates through three segments: Agency and Related Business, Professional Logistics, and E-commerce. The company offers sea freight, air freight, rail freight, shipping agency, terminals and containers, yards, feeder/barges, logistics information systems, and supply chain security. Financial Performance

In 2025, Sinotrans's revenue was 96.81 billion, a decrease of -8.34% compared to the previous year's 105.62 billion. Earnings were 4.02 billion, an increase of 2.66%.
